Title: Dell Boomi Developer Location: Irving, TXJob Type: ContractJob Description:-We are seeking an experienced
Boomi Developer with a strong background in both
integration development and support. The ideal candidate will have hands-on experience with
Dell Boomi, a good understanding/experience of
Azure Integration Services, and
programming skills (preferably in .Net). You will be responsible for building and supporting scalable integration solutions across cloud and on-premises applications, ensuring smooth data flow and system connectivity.
Key Responsibilities: - Design, build, and maintain integration solutions using Dell Boomi.
- Provide production support, troubleshoot integration issues, and ensure SLAs are met.
- Enhance and optimize existing Boomi processes and integrations.
- Develop and maintain .NET-based components or utilities to support integration processes.
- Integrate applications and services hosted on Microsoft Azure (e.g., Azure Logic Apps, Azure Functions, Service Bus).
- Collaborate with stakeholders to gather requirements and translate them into integration designs.
- Ensure proper logging, monitoring, and error-handling mechanisms are implemented.
- Create and maintain comprehensive documentation for processes and support runbooks.
- Participate in on-call support rotation, if required.
Required Skills and Qualifications: - Bachelor's degree in Computer Science, Engineering, or related field.
- Minimum 3-6 years of experience with Dell Boomi, including development and support.
- Strong experience with data mapping, transformation, and Boomi connectors (e.g., HTTP, Database, Salesforce).
- Working knowledge of Microsoft Azure Integration Services.
- Proficiency in .NET / C# development.
- Solid understanding of web services (REST/SOAP), JSON, XML, and SQL.
- Experience in troubleshooting, performance tuning, and handling large volumes of data in integration flows.
- Experience with Azure Logic Apps, Azure Functions, and Service Bus.
- Exposure to Agile/Scrum methodologies.
- Strong analytical and problem-solving skills.
- Effective communication skills (verbal and written).
- Ability to multitask and prioritize in a fast-paced environment.
- Collaborative mindset with the ability to work across teams.